Searching words with the five vowels
lst = DictionaryLookup[{"Spanish",
x__ /; And @@ (StringCount[x, #] == 1 & /@ {"a", "e", "i", "o", "u"})}];
Short @ lst
{abrenuncio, aceituno, ...
